Jim, Our experience says no to baking on tape and reel or tubes (tape and reel not marked with any temperature information will start to melt). I had to find waffle trays from our stack of them with the space and height to accommodate the parts (will not be exact). We removed the parts from the tape and reel near the temperature chamber, place them inside two trays (one on top of the other),taped together using kapton tape and then place into the temperature chamber. We have a PQFP-64 that we received on a real and the moisture sensitivity level is 3. The package has been opened and has exceeded the maximum exposure time and requires the component to be baked for a minimum of 8hrs @ 125°C. In the past we received these on trays and baking them was not an issue. Can I bake these while on the reel? Do we need to extend the baking time?
